Kentucky is off to a 1-4 record, a record they haven’t had since 1984, Joe B. Hall’s last season. But the young Cats showed some heart and fight in the second half when at one point they went on a 16-0 run and also got the deficit down to just ONE point, but Olivier Sarr missed a tip in at the buzzer and Kentucky fell to Notre Dame 64-63. They have another chance to bounce back when they face UNC in the 2020 CBS Sports Classic in Cleveland.
The Tarheels are off to a 4-2 start and this will be the third game between the two teams and Kentucky has two wins over UNC in both CBS Sports Classics but the Tarheels have a 24-19 record over the Cats.
Kentucky was orignially suppose to play UCLA but things got flipped so UCLA will now play Ohio State and Kentucky plays UNC.
These two blue bloods go head to head in Cleveland, OH this Saturday at 2 p.m. ET on CBS
